To commemorate the 20th anniversary of the Alamo Drafthouse, the chain has announced a series of exciting events that will take place throughout the rest of the year as a way of celebrating their commitment towards creating a fantastic theater experience. This celebration will include screenings, events, and reunions as well as brand new merchandise through the chain’s Mondo brand. More info on everything can be found here.

One of the ways they’re celebrating is by honoring the 30th anniversary of Fred Dekker’s classic children’s horror movie The Monster Squad with a nationwide tour that will feature live appearances by stars Andre Gower, Ryan Lambert, and Ashley Bank (Sean, little sister Phoebe, and Rudy, respectively)! The plan is for this to happen in late August, so if there’s a Drafthouse in your area, keep your eyes peeled for showtimes! More information about The Monster Squad can be found right here.
